Greenland Premier: No Deal with US on Natural Resources, Respect for Sovereignty is Key

2 connectionsΒ·3 entities in this videoβGreenland's Stance on US Interest in Resources
- β The Premier of Greenland, Jens-Frederik Nielsen, stated he is unaware of any existing deal between the US and Denmark regarding Greenland.
- π‘ He welcomes respectful conversations about cooperation on Greenland's mineral resources and acknowledges the island's huge potential.
- β οΈ Any exploitation of resources must respect Greenland's legislation and high environmental standards, which are integral to their culture.
- π€ A diplomatic and respectful approach is crucial for a strong partnership, and Greenland is ready to discuss these matters.
Sovereignty and International Relations
- π£οΈ Regarding President Trump's statements, Nielsen emphasizes the need to believe what he says about not taking Greenland by force.
- π He places faith in the established world order and international law that have maintained peace for many years.
- π‘οΈ Greenland views itself as a close ally of the western alliance and believes in respecting territorial integrity.
- π Nielsen expresses confidence that the world will not drastically change its stance and that the western alliance can foster growth through good partnership.
